Hope Baker, M.D., is an Associate Professor of Medicine in the Gastroenterology Division of the UT Health San Antonio Department of Medicine and serves as the Director of Hepatology at Robert B Green Campus of University Health System. She has specific interest and expertise in treating viral hepatitis, chronic liver disease, cirrhosis, and portal hypertension. She also performs diagnostic endoscopy and diagnostic and screening colonoscopies.
